The Global Textured Soy Protein Market was estimated at USD 3.1 Billion in 2025 and is projected to reach USD 4.6 Billion by 2032, growing at a CAGR of 7.10% from 2026 to 2032.
Currently, the Global Textured Soy Protein Market is rapidly evolving, influenced by the growing shift towards plant-based diets. This movement is primarily fueled by consumers increasingly seeking sustainable protein sources for health and environmental considerations. Notably, the food processing industry's expanding capabilities are enhancing the versatility of textured soy protein, allowing for diverse applications in food products.
The dynamics of this market are not just about health; they involve broader societal changes. A significant awareness regarding animal welfare and the environmental impact of traditional meat production is steering consumer preferences towards textured soy protein. This transition is coupled with strategic innovation from major players, who are diversifying their offerings to meet varying dietary requirements.

The Global Textured Soy Protein Market faces critical challenges that could hinder its growth trajectory. Chief among these is the volatility in raw soybean prices, with fluctuations averaging 15% over the past three years. This instability poses risks to profit margins for manufacturers, who often operate with narrow margins. For example, a recent spike in soybean prices pushed production costs up by approximately 10%, squeezing the financial viability of smaller producers. Moreover, limited consumer awareness regarding the benefits of textured soy protein restricts market penetration in various segments.
One prominent trend is the rise in product innovation specifically aimed at creating meat alternatives. Companies like ADM are investing in R&D to develop new formulations that appeal to a broader audience, including flexitarians. For example, the launch of ADM's new range of meat substitutes last year caters specifically to this demographic, aligning with shifting consumer behaviors towards plant-based proteins. Additionally, the market is witnessing advancements in production technologies, such as extrusion methods enhancing the texture and taste of soy protein products. This operational shift enables manufacturers to meet the rising quality expectations of consumers.
The forecasted growth opportunities within the Global Textured Soy Protein Market are vast. One significant avenue lies in the increasing demand for dairy alternatives, particularly in the Asia Pacific region where the market for soy-based yogurt is expected to grow by 30% through 2032. Companies like So Delicious are already capitalizing on this trend by introducing innovative soy products aimed at health-conscious consumers. Another promising opportunity is within the pet food sector, where textured soy protein is being recognized for its nutritional benefits in premium pet food formulations, opening new revenue streams for manufacturers.
The largest segment in the Global Textured Soy Protein Market is Non-GMO, commanding approximately 50% share in 2025. This preference primarily arises from consumer concerns about health and environmental sustainability. Conversely, the fastest-growing segment is Organic, projected to experience a CAGR of 9.5% from 2026 to 2032. The increasing availability of certified organic soybeans and consumer demand for clean label products contribute to this significant growth, enhancing its attractiveness as a competitive offering.
The Food Meat Substitutes segment is the largest in the Global Textured Soy Protein Market, accounting for about 60% share in 2025. This dominance reflects the rising trend among consumers towards plant-based diets as a viable substitute for traditional proteins. In contrast, the fastest-growing application area is Dairy Alternatives, expected to see a CAGR of 8.0% from 2026 to 2032. This growth is driven by the increasing popularity of soy-based yogurts and cheeses, which cater to lactose-intolerant consumers and those pursuing a plant-based lifestyle.
Soy protein isolates represent the largest segment in the Global Textured Soy Protein Market, with an estimated share of 55% in 2025. Their high protein content and functional versatility make them a preferred choice across various food applications. On the other hand, Soy protein concentrates are expected to grow at a CAGR of 8.4% from 2026 to 2032, driven by their cost-effectiveness and appeal in producing meat analogs, thereby increasing their market penetrability.
The Asia Pacific region is the largest for the Global Textured Soy Protein Market, holding approximately 45% share in 2025. This region's dominance stems from a significant increase in plant-based food consumption, particularly in countries like China and India. Furthermore, Asia Pacific is also identified as the fastest-growing market, projected to experience a CAGR of 8.2% from 2026 to 2032. This growth can be attributed to rising disposable incomes, urbanization, and the influence of Western dietary trends.

The competitive landscape of the Global Textured Soy Protein Market is moderately consolidated, dominated by a few key players leveraging their expertise and scale. These companies benefit from strong supply chains and established market positions, ensuring they can meet rising consumer demands while also addressing sustainability issues.
| Leading Company | Core Strength | Strategic Focus |
|---|---|---|
| Danfoss | Innovative processing technology for protein extraction. | Expanding into dairy alternatives with new product lines. |
| Dupont | Strong R&D capabilities in plant-based foods. | Diversification into snack foods using textured soy proteins. |
| Cargill | Robust supply chain and production capacity. | Increasing production capacity through new facilities. |
| ADM | Extensive portfolio of plant-based products. | Focus on meat alternatives; expecting new product launches. |
| Bühler | Leader in automation and food processing equipment. | Enhancing production efficiency through advanced technologies. |
The competition among these players is gearing towards innovation, managing sustainability challenges, and addressing consumer preferences, especially in plant-based protein formulations.
